Welcome to LiftSim! Before you review any dispatch-logic PRs, get the simulator running locally so you can sanity-check elevator behavior yourself — trust me, reading hall-call traces in CI logs is miserable. Clone the repo, run `make cars`, and copy `env.sample` to `.env`. Most settings (car count, floor height, door dwell) are fine as-is for the Harrowgate Tower scenario. The one thing you need to add manually is the credential for the Velloway telemetry sink. Drop this line into your `.env`:

sealed setting: VAULT_KEY20=c8ea1e419912889df6b4

**Key ceremony — step 7 (FillCast planner)**

Once both witnesses from the Bramblegate ops team have signed the log, seal the hardware token for the FillCast restock planner in the tamper bag and stash it in the Dray Street safe. Before sealing, verify the token unlocks the escrow share. For that check, use the recovery passphrase below.

vault phrase of hahop-badug = novvan-ulaion-zorius-noviel-gorwyn-casix-tamys

# Hey plugin folks! This is the env file for Gridletter, our crossword
# generator. Plugins get called during grid fill and clue generation, so
# keep your hooks fast — anything over 200ms gets skipped. Word lists live
# in the Lexbarn service; themes and rebus rules are plain JSON in the
# config dir. Most settings below are safe to tweak. The one exception is
# the credential Gridletter uses to fetch premium word lists from Lexbarn,
# which goes on the next line:

env line for fafof-fahag: LEDGER_TOKEN5=f8790

# Circuit breaker for the Ostergate Payments API.
#
# The upstream degrades gradually rather than failing outright, so the
# breaker trips on a rolling error-rate window, not consecutive failures.
# While open, requests fail fast and we serve the last known settlement
# state; the half-open probe sends a single request per interval. On-call:
# if you see repeated open/half-open flapping, widen the window before
# raising the error threshold — flapping usually means the sample is too
# small. Tuned values from the January load exercise:

tuning table, yajog-yahof:
BUDGETS = {
    "lamvan": 303,
    "wenox": 460,
    "fenvan": 525,
}